Moisture in compressed air can block control airlines, damage tools, and cause water hammer, leading to equipment damage. It also promotes corrosion, creating rust and scale that can foul lines and damage components. To avoid contaminating your products or damaging your system, you can install dryers to remove excess moisture from gas outputs and ensure everything works optimally.

Variable frequency drives (VFDs) are advanced control devices that can adjust the motor speed of air compressors according to demand. By optimizing energy consumption and eliminating the need for constant full-speed operation, VFDs result in significant energy savings and increased efficiency, leading to substantial cost reductions.

How Variable Frequency Drives Work

When a VFD is connected to an air compressor system, it continuously monitors the air demand and adjusts the motor speed accordingly. At the core of this machine is a variable speed drive (VSD) drivetrain, which consists of three main components: a rectifier, a DC bus, and an inverter. 

The rectifier converts the incoming AC power from the electrical grid into DC power. The DC bus acts as an intermediate energy storage system, smoothing out voltage fluctuations. The inverter then converts the DC power back into AC power with variable frequency and voltage to control the motor speed.

The VSD motor, also known as a variable or adjustable speed motor, is designed to operate in conjunction with VFDs. These machines are efficient and versatile, specifically designed to handle varying speeds, allowing them to adapt to changing load demands and ensuring your operations run smoothly. They work efficiently across a wide range of speeds, maintaining high torque at lower speeds and reducing energy consumption compared to fixed-speed motors.

What Are the Applications of Variable Frequency Drives?

Used across various industries, here are a few applications of VFDs in the Philippines:

Industrial Machinery

VFDs help control the speed of motors in conveyors, mixers, agitators, and other equipment, providing flexibility in operation and enhancing process efficiency. They also enable motors to start and stop softly, reducing mechanical stress and extending equipment life span. Additionally, they facilitate energy savings by matching motor speed with varying production requirements.

Water Treatment Systems

Often used in water treatment facilities, VFDs regulate the operation of pumps, blowers, and aerators, ensuring precise control of water flow and pressure. By adjusting motor speed to match the demand, they optimize energy consumption, resulting in significant cost savings. They also provide enhanced process control, improving water quality and enabling efficient treatment operations.

Oil and Gas Plants

VFDs control the speed of electric motors, driving pumps, compressors, and fans used in extraction, refining, and distribution processes. They enable precise control over flow rates, pressure, and temperature, ensuring optimal operation and energy efficiency. By adjusting motor speed based on real-time demand, they help increase energy savings and reduce operating costs.
